Handover: TaxRate Cache (Ledgerbird)

Hey Priya — quick brain dump before I'm out. The tax-rate lookup cache in Ledgerbird is now warming on deploy, so cold-start lookups shouldn't spike anymore. TTL is 6 hours; the Vennland regional rates still refresh nightly via the Quillport job. One gotcha: if the cache store loses quorum, it locks itself and needs a manual unseal before writes resume. Tooling for that lives in ops/unseal.md. When prompted during unseal, enter the recovery passphrase exactly as written below.

unlock words, hahip-baduf: holwyn-istath-julvan

Handover for the Ostrel proctoring queue, prepared for the quarterly security review. The queue now enforces per-session signing and rejects unsigned exam events; retention was reduced to 14 days per the Branholt policy update. No open incidents. Dmitra completed the broker upgrade last week and verified consumer lag is nominal. The service currently runs with the configuration values listed below.

settings of tahag-tahag:
[istdor]
host = istdor.tolvaqcorp.corp
user = istdor_svc
database = istdor_prod

You'll be helping with the Lanternleaf consent banner rollout. Quick context: we're replacing the old Cookiegate banner with Lanternleaf across all Marrowby-hosted properties, region by region, starting with the Veldane market. Copy changes go through legal review — never tweak banner text directly, even for typos. The rollout flags live in the `lanternleaf-flags` dashboard; you'll get access on day two. Read the region checklist before toggling anything. If a flag does something weird or a region looks wrong, email the rollout coordinators.

alerts address for bajop-yahog: istwyn@lumiclabs.internal